## Sensor drift: what to do at 3am

If the GrowLoop controller starts reporting humidity swings that don't match the backup probes in the Fernwick greenhouse, it's almost always sensor drift, not an actual climate event. Don't panic and don't touch the vents manually. First, restart the calibration daemon and give it ten minutes to re-baseline. If readings still disagree by more than 5%, flip the controller into safe mode. The safe-mode thresholds it will use are these.

config for yahap-bajof:
[istix]
host = istix.qorvelsys.internal
user = istix_svc
database = istix_prod

Approvals — Checkout Load Testing (Marrowgate Storefront). Load tests against the checkout flow require written approval before any run exceeding 500 virtual users, since staging shares a payment sandbox with the Tillhaven team. Support should never trigger these tests directly; file a request instead. All load test approvals for the checkout flow are granted by:

approver of bagug-bagag = Holael Pramir

Runbook: Relevance tuning for the Marrowtide search cluster. Tuning notes live in the shared notebook; each experiment gets a dated entry with the boost weights tried and the click-through delta observed. As a contractor, never push weight changes straight to production — apply them to the shadow index first and let the comparison job run for 24 hours. The tuning harness reads its settings from tuner.env in the ops repo. For the harness to write results back to the metrics store, add this line:

env line for fafof-fahag: LEDGER_TOKEN5=f8790